i don't think there's much destruction, unless most of it took place when they disassembled things for auction. most of the valuable contents of the regal constellation hotel were sold via auction. i heard they sold wood work, light fixtures, and the chandeliers. i've always wanted to explore this place... it's like a classic old toronto hotel that celebrities, etc. used to stay at. it was hot in it's hayday. supposedly years and years ago the hotel was sold to a group of chinese business men and was 'run to the ground' [basically] when the employees formed a union. before they purchased the building it was heavily renovated and no expense was spared e.g. marble work, granite work etc. it was an expensive project but the previous owner made large $$$ on the sale. the hotel has been sitting there ever since, and from what i can tell it looks like it's in poor shape. it is a concrete structure that is deteriorating and will eventually have to be demolished. there is no cost-effective way of attempting to rebuild the current structure. that hotel used to be 'the shit' back in the day. there was nothing like it in terms of banquet facilities, etc. very nice pictures... the demise of the regal constellation. i guess it's a fucking heatscore [now] so i have to stay away [for now]

| | | In the old tower at the Regal, most of the room doors have been blown off their hinges for breach training. Lots of holes between rooms as well. Bloweduprealgood.
